Call for Proposals to Develop Capacity to Enforce Mandatory Heavy Duty Vehicle Inspections Programme (Uganda)

Deadline: 23-May-23

The Climate and Clean Air Coalition (CCAC) is inviting proposals to build capacity within key government authorities in Uganda to implement the standards, including through a mandatory vehicle inspection programme.

This project responds to a request made by the Ministry of Water and Environment of Uganda to build capacity for the implementation of EURO 4/IV emission standards.

Successful delivery of this project will require close coordination and engagement across several line ministries, including the Ministry of Works and Transport, Ministry of Energy, Ministry of Water and Environment, Ministry Finance, Planning and Economic Development, and Ministry of Local Government. This project may also include participation of city and municipal authorities, the National Environment Management Authority, and National Planning Authority.

This project is expected to launch in Q1 2024.
